Output 5bb33ee73c3b4952e69c3b8786a5740b4625ff7d9724d59caeb285e3f5ae6c74:3

value
745177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ed3003afca0b79123761b860fbc683fd5964dd42 OP_EQUAL
address
3PK9b78yeCLdpo39GJuCSeEqUpEiwyYdvn
transaction
5bb33ee73c3b4952e69c3b8786a5740b4625ff7d9724d59caeb285e3f5ae6c74
confirmations
355501
spent
true